APC: victory in FCT, Rivers, Kano a referendum on Tinubu govt
AI Summary
The All Progressives Congress (APC) won five of six chairmanship seats in the Federal Capital Territory and secured state constituency seats in Rivers and Kano during recent by‑elections. The party described the results as a referendum on President Bola Ahmed Tinubu’s administration, with APC National Chairman Prof. Nentanwe Yilwatda and the President praising the outcomes and urging elected officials to serve responsibly. The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) won one chairmanship seat in the FCT. The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) and security agencies were commended for facilitating peaceful voting. The victories are being framed as endorsement of the government’s reform agenda ahead of upcoming electoral cycles.
